Specific function: The Disulfide Bond Functions As An Electron Carrier In The Glutathione-Dependent Synthesis Of Deoxyribonucleotides By The Enzyme Ribonucleotide Reductase. In Addition, It Is Also Involved In Reducing Some Disulfides In A Coupled System With Glutathione R
